Abstract
The application discloses a cosmetic circulation information tracing method and device based on a block chain, which are applied to block chain nodes, wherein the method comprises the following steps: receiving a cosmetic factory information uplink request sent by a service node, wherein the service node is a manufacturer node, and the cosmetic factory information uplink request comprises a private key signature of the service node; verifying the private key signature of the service node by using the public key of the service node; and after the verification is passed, packaging the cosmetic delivery information into a first block, so that the block chain system stores the first block into a block chain after performing consensus verification on the first block. The method can store the circulation information of the cosmetics into the block chain, and is convenient for a user to inquire, so that the problem of fake cosmetics is solved.

Disclosure of Invention
Based on the problems, the application discloses a cosmetic circulation information tracing method and a device thereof based on a block chain.
The application discloses a cosmetic circulation information tracing method based on a block chain, which is applied to a block chain node, and the method comprises the following steps:
receiving a cosmetic factory information uplink request sent by a service node, wherein the service node is a manufacturer node, and the cosmetic factory information uplink request comprises a private key signature of the service node;
verifying the private key signature of the service node by using the public key of the service node;
and after the verification is passed, packaging the cosmetic delivery information into a first block, so that the block chain system stores the first block into a block chain after performing consensus verification on the first block.
In one possible embodiment, the method further comprises: receiving a cosmetic buying and selling information chaining request sent by a merchant node, wherein the cosmetic buying and selling information chaining request comprises a private key signature of the merchant node;
verifying the private key signature of the merchant node by using the merchant node public key;
and after the verification is passed, packaging the cosmetic buying and selling information into a second block, so that the second block is subjected to consensus verification by a block chain system and then stored into a block chain.
In one possible embodiment, the method further comprises: receiving a cosmetic circulation information query request sent by user equipment, wherein the cosmetic circulation information query request comprises a private key signature of the user equipment, and the user equipment is registered user equipment of the block chain system;
verifying the private key signature of the user equipment by using the public key of the user equipment;
and after the verification is passed, transmitting the circulation information of the cosmetics to the user equipment, wherein the circulation information of the cosmetics comprises the delivery information of the cosmetics and the purchase and sale information of the cosmetics.
In a possible implementation manner, the cosmetic circulation information query request includes information of cosmetics, so that the block link point queries the cosmetic circulation information according to the information of the cosmetics; wherein the content of the first and second substances,
the information of the cosmetics generates the hash value of the cosmetics through a hash algorithm, and the hash value of the cosmetics is stored on a block chain; wherein the information of the cosmetics comprises one or more of cosmetic type, cosmetic name, manufacturer name, production date and effective period.
In one possible embodiment, the cosmetic marketing information includes a seller of the cosmetic, a purchaser of the cosmetic, a name of the cosmetic, and a marketing date;
the cosmetic delivery information comprises the name of the cosmetic, the name of a manufacturer and the delivery date of the cosmetic.
In one possible implementation manner, the user equipment inquires the cosmetic product factory information and the cosmetic product purchase and sale information corresponding to the cosmetic product by scanning a two-dimensional code of the cosmetic product.
In one possible embodiment, the method further comprises: receiving comment information of cosmetics sent by the user equipment; and packaging the comment information of the cosmetics into a third block, so that the third block is subjected to consensus verification by a block chain system and then stored into a block chain.
